Dareecha (Urdu: دریچہ, lit.'Window') is a Pakistani horror-mystery soap television series that aired during 2011–12 on ARY Digital.[1] It was produced by Abdullah Seja and Jeerjes Seja under Idream Entertainment. It featured Fazila Qazi, Sana Askari, Imran Aslam, Yasir Hussain Sonya Hussyn in pivot roles.[2][3][4][5]

Synopsis

[edit]

The drama focuses on the main character Maheen, who faces many challenges in life due to her love marriage with Faizan. Faizan, a psychologically disturbed man, tortures every woman he marries. In the past he has married 4 other women and harmed them physically and mentally. He plans to do the same to Maheen. Soon after, with the help of her sixth sense, Maheen begins to realize that Faizan's family and past has been impacted with black magic. Furthermore, suspense occurs when Maheen begins to see ghosts of the dead. She must find out Faizan's past and the hidden truths.[6]
